Télécharger la présentation
La présentation est en train de télécharger. S'il vous plaît, attendez
Publié parGéraldine Larochelle Modifié depuis plus de 8 années
1
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 1 Chapitre 3 Algorithmes « classiques »
2
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 2 1. Importance d’un bon algorithme Recherche Internet Auto-suggestion Géolocalisation / Guidage Reconnaissance vocale Ciblage marketing Cryptographie Compression Jeux … →Vitesse →Performance
3
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 3 2. Qualité d’un algorithme Exactitude (prise en compte des cas d’erreurs) Temps d’exécution Compréhension / Intuitivité (Heuristique)
4
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 4 3. Algorithmes de recherche 81 ? Force brute 348196228
5
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 5 3. Algorithmes de recherche 81 ? Dichotomie 228348196 8196
6
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 6 3. Algorithmes de recherche Algorithmes de recherche de chemin Algorithme de Dijkstra A*
7
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 7 4. Algorithmes de tri Force brute 813496228 2 348196
8
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 8 4. Algorithmes de tri 813496228 234968128 2 968134 228348196 228348196 Par sélection
9
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 9 4. Algorithmes de tri Tri à bulles 453476228 344576228 344576228 344527628 344522876
10
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 10 4. Algorithmes de tri 344522876 344522876 342452876 342284576 342284576
11
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 11 4. Algorithmes de tri 342284576 234284576 228344576 228344576 228344576
12
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 12 4. Algorithmes de tri Tri par insertion Tri fusion …
13
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 13 5. Complexité Exemples : Tri par sélection : n*(n-1)/2 itérations →complexité O(n²) Tri fusion : →complexité O(n log n)
14
Université Paul Sabatier - Toulouse 3 Accueil des nouveaux personnels – Promotion 2007 IUT A – Service Direction – 19 août 2004 14 Références E. Conchon : cours DUT SRC
Présentations similaires
© 2024 SlidePlayer.fr Inc.
All rights reserved.